Consider the points below in detail if you’re inclined to think that old marketing ploy of examination guarantees seems like a good idea:

Obviously it isn’t free – you’re still coughing up for it – it’s just been included in your package price. It’s well known in the industry that when trainees fund their relevant examinations, one after the other, they will be much more likely to pass first time – since they’re aware of their payment and therefore will put more effort into their preparation.

Go for the best offer you can find at the time, and avoid college mark-up fees. In addition, it’s then your choice where to do the examinations – which means you can stay local. Including money in your training package for examinations (plus interest – if you’re financing your study) is madness. Why fill a company’s coffers with extra money of yours simply to help their cash-flow! There are those who hope that you won’t get round to taking them – then they’ll keep the extra money. The majority of organisations will require you to sit pre-tests and prohibit you from re-taking an exam until you’ve completely proven that you’re likely to pass – making an ‘exam guarantee’ just about worthless.

Prometric and VUE exams are in the region of 112 pounds in Great Britain. Why spend so much more on ‘Exam Guarantee’ costs (often hidden in the cost) – when good quality study materials, the proper support and exam preparation systems and a dose of commitment and effort are what’s required.

With great home lighting, you can make a plain space look great and a great space look fantastic. Light affects how we perceive spaces and the items within them. A good lighting plan should create a cozy, inviting space and add sparkle to treasured art work and furnishings.

Besides the electric lighting fixtures, natural light should also flow uninterrupted into the rooms. You can achieve this by removing secondary glazing on the window, replacing heavy curtains with light drapes. Also, placing a mirror near the window makes it look larger and brighter.

One should have the knowledge about the basic type of lighting fixtures that can be used in our homes before choosing any.

The first category is that of general lighting. It is used for general illumination purpose in the home. These are ceiling mounted lighting fixtures which include florescent and halogen lights. Halogen lights can be dimmed and gives a more flattering glow in the room.

The second category includes task lighting fixtures. These are used for specific purposes like reading, cooking, applying makeup and so are used in various areas of the home. Lamps with adjustable arms are the most common lighting fixtures in this category. These should be glare free so that one does not have to strain his/ her eyes.

Accent lighting – is focused lighting that is used to illuminate a sculpture, piece of art, or architectural element in a room. Accent lighting is about three times as bright as ambient lighting.

Decorative Lighting – Their sole purpose is not illumination but decoration. Decorative lights like dramatic chandeliers and colorful silk lanterns will look good even when unlit.

The key to good lighting is layering. Using just one light source for the whole space might be the easy way out, but it wont be able to bring your interiors to life. Know the different types of lights and the kind of illumination they provide. Then use a mix to create a captivating ambiance, depending on the function of the space.
